In the world of testing, ensuring a smooth and efficient supply chain for test resources is crucial to maintaining high-quality outcomes. However, just like any other supply chain, issues can arise that impact the process. In this blog post, we will explore common challenges that testing teams may face in their supply chain for test resources and provide tips for troubleshooting and resolving these issues effectively. 1. **Delayed Deliveries**: One of the most common problems in the test resources supply chain is delayed deliveries. This can happen due to various reasons such as logistical issues, supplier delays, or unforeseen circumstances. To address this issue, it is essential to communicate proactively with suppliers and have contingency plans in place. Keeping track of orders and maintaining open lines of communication can help mitigate the impact of delayed deliveries. 2. **Quality Control**: Another challenge that testing teams may encounter is maintaining quality control throughout the supply chain. It is important to ensure that test resources meet the required standards and specifications. Implementing quality control measures at each stage of the supply chain can help identify issues early on and prevent defective products from being used in testing processes. 3. **Resource Allocation**: Proper resource allocation is crucial for maximizing efficiency in the testing process. However, resource constraints or mismanagement can lead to bottlenecks and delays. To troubleshoot resource allocation issues, testing teams should conduct regular assessments of resource needs and availability. Adjusting resource allocation based on project requirements and priorities can help optimize the testing process. 4. **Budget Constraints**: Budget constraints can also pose challenges in the test resources supply chain. Testing teams may face pressure to cut costs while ensuring high-quality outcomes. To address budget constraints, teams can explore cost-saving opportunities such as bulk purchasing, negotiating better deals with suppliers, or utilizing open-source resources. Implementing efficient budgeting strategies can help maintain a healthy balance between cost-effectiveness and quality. 5. **Technology Integration**: Integrating technology into the test resources supply chain can streamline processes and enhance efficiency. However, technological challenges such as compatibility issues or system failures can disrupt operations. Troubleshooting technology integration issues requires a systematic approach, including thorough testing, regular updates, and collaboration with IT teams to resolve technical issues promptly. By being proactive and addressing these common challenges effectively, testing teams can optimize their supply chain for test resources and ensure smooth testing processes. Implementing best practices, maintaining open communication with suppliers, and continuously evaluating and improving processes can help mitigate risks and enhance the efficiency and effectiveness of the testing supply chain.
